Wilhelmina LEPPENS was born 17 October 1830 in Knegsel, Noord Brabant, Netherlands
Wilhelmina LEPPENS was the child of Johannes "John" LEPPENS and Maria BEIJNENWilhelmina was an immigrant to the United States, arriving by 1854.
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Wilhelmina married Mathias Joannes HENDRIKS 28 November 1863 in Little Chute, Outagamie, Wisconsin, USA .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Mathias Joannes HENDRIKS was born 14 February 1831 in Sambeek, Noord Brabant, Netherlands. Mathias Joannes died 24 June 1867 in Little Chute, Outagamie, Wisconsin, USA. Mathias Joannes was the child of Peter HENDRICKS and Anna WILLEMS.
Wilhelmina LEPPENS died 18 January 1877 in Little Chute, Outagamie, Wisconsin, USA.
